    Employee Transportation Trends in India: What Businesses Need to Know

    Updated on
    Share:

    Employee transportation in India has evolved from being a basic facility to a critical part of business strategy. With rapid urbanization, longer travel distances, and increasing traffic congestion, the daily commute has become a defining factor in an employee’s overall work experience. Businesses today are realizing that how employees travel to and from work directly impacts productivity, punctuality, and job satisfaction. As a result, organizations are actively rethinking their employee transportation systems to make them more efficient, reliable, and employee-centric.

    The Shift Toward Organized Employee Transportation Services

    In the past, many employees relied heavily on public transport or personal vehicles for their daily commute. However, unpredictable schedules, overcrowding, and lack of reliability have pushed companies to adopt more structured transportation solutions. Businesses across India are now investing in organized employee transport services such as dedicated cabs and shuttle buses.

    These systems are designed to provide consistency, reduce delays, and ensure that employees reach the workplace on time. This shift not only improves operational efficiency but also reduces the stress employees often associate with daily travel.

    The Growing Importance of Safety and Compliance

    Safety has become one of the most important aspects of employee transportation, especially for organizations that operate in shifts or have late working hours. Companies are expected to provide secure commuting options, particularly for women employees.

    Modern transport systems now include features like GPS tracking, verified chauffeurs, and real-time monitoring to ensure every journey is safe. Additionally, compliance with government regulations and company policies has become essential. Businesses that prioritize safety are not only meeting legal requirements but also building a strong sense of trust among their workforce.

    Technology is Transforming Employee Mobility

    Technology is playing a major role in reshaping employee transportation in India. Companies are adopting advanced mobility platforms that automate and streamline transport operations. These systems allow businesses to manage routes, assign vehicles, and track trips in real time.

    Employees can access mobile apps to check pickup timings, track their rides, and receive notifications. This level of transparency reduces uncertainty and enhances the commuting experience. At the same time, businesses benefit from improved efficiency and better control over transportation costs.

    The Rise of Shared Mobility and Carpooling

    With increasing traffic congestion and rising fuel costs, shared mobility has become a practical solution for many organizations. Companies are encouraging employees to share rides through carpooling or shared car rental services.

    This approach helps reduce the number of vehicles on the road, leading to less congestion and lower environmental impact. Shared transportation also allows businesses to optimize their resources and manage costs more effectively. For employees, it offers a balance between convenience and affordability to make daily commuting more manageable.

    Hybrid Work Models Are Redefining Commute Patterns

    The adoption of hybrid work models has significantly changed how employees commute. Many employees no longer travel to the office every day, which has reduced the overall demand for transportation services. However, it has also introduced new challenges for businesses, such as managing fluctuating demand and unpredictable schedules.

    To address this, companies are moving toward flexible transport solutions that can adapt to changing requirements. Dynamic routing and on-demand transport services are becoming more common to let organizations align transportation with actual employee needs.

    Sustainability is Becoming a Key Priority

    Sustainability is no longer just a trend; it is a responsibility that businesses are taking seriously. Employee transportation is one of the areas where companies can make a significant environmental impact.

    Many organizations are exploring the use of electric vehicles, fuel-efficient fleets, and shared mobility solutions to reduce their carbon footprint. By adopting greener transportation practices, businesses not only contribute to environmental conservation but also strengthen their brand image. Employees are increasingly drawn to companies that demonstrate a commitment to sustainability.

    Enhancing Comfort and Convenience for Employees

    The expectations of employees have changed over time, and transportation is no exception. Today’s workforce values comfort and convenience as part of their daily commute. Long travel hours in crowded or poorly maintained vehicles can lead to fatigue and reduced productivity.

    To address this, companies are focusing on providing clean, comfortable, and well maintained transport options. Reliable pickup and drop services, minimal waiting times, and a smooth travel experience all contribute to improved employee satisfaction. A comfortable commute can make a significant difference in how employees feel about their workday.

    Data-Driven Transportation Management

    Data has become a powerful tool in optimizing employee transportation systems. Businesses are using data analytics to gain insights into travel patterns, route efficiency, and vehicle utilization. This information helps organizations identify inefficiencies and make informed decisions to improve their transport operations.

    By analyzing data, companies can reduce costs, minimize delays, and enhance overall service quality. Data-driven strategies enable continuous improvement and ensure that transportation systems remain aligned with business goals.

    Cost Optimization Without Compromising Quality

    Managing transportation costs is a major concern for businesses, especially as fuel prices and operational expenses continue to rise. However, reducing costs should not come at the expense of employee experience.

    Companies are finding ways to balance cost efficiency with service quality by adopting shared mobility, optimizing routes, and leveraging technology. Partnering with experienced mobility providers also helps businesses achieve better results. A well managed transportation system can deliver both cost savings and a positive employee experience.

    Building a Future-Ready Employee Transportation Strategy

    As the workplace continues to evolve, businesses must take a forward-looking approach to employee transportation. This involves regularly assessing current systems, adopting new technologies, and staying responsive to employee needs.

    Organizations should also seek feedback from employees to understand their commuting challenges and preferences. A future-ready transportation strategy is one that is flexible, efficient, and aligned with broader business objectives. Companies that invest in modern mobility solutions will be better equipped to handle changing demands.
